The late Mrs Mary Hooper,who death occurred at her resident, Allnutt Street, onTuesday last,at the age of 75 yrs was 1 of a band of Canterbury pioneers who Came to NZ in the sailing ship Clontarf landing at Lyttleton 73 yrs ago when She was a child of 2 yrs.her parents were the late William and Ann Chapman and after landing her father entered employ of G G Tripp at Peel Forest as a Gardener. Later, the family came to Temuka where Mrs Hooper resided for 52 Yrs. Her husband was Thomas Francis Hooper, who predeceased her 17 yrs ago and who at one period was president of the Temuka Caledonian Society.Mrs Hooper was a native of Winsford, Somerset and an adherent of the Anglican Church. She led a quiet life,and rarely public functions,but was much respected by a wide circle of acquaintances. As one of the pioneers of Temuka ,she was entrusted with the duty of unveiling the coronation memorial drinking fountain at the main enterance to the Temuka domain on the occasion of the coronation of the present king.the deceased leaves 5 sons and four daughters viz..-messers Mr Thomas Francis Hooper,Culverden.Charles Edwin Hooper,Washdyke.Guy Francis And William Richard,Temuka And Samuel James,Wanganui.Mesdames..-J H Sim ,Temuka.E Eastwood,Timaru.H Pullen,Spreydon.G S Walters,Linwood.
